Here's a few of these Sprinters out on the market. I must say though the best one we have seen is the Winnebago version.

Many Class-C RV's only get 18mpg at best. The Sprinter has placed the Class-C market into the 22~27mpg actual range depending on weight an options from various manufactures. The Sprinter is breathing new life back into the RV industy since fuel is now a killer for many.

The TRAKKA Jabiru is a highly refined luxury Motorhome that is fully equipped with built-in shower and toilet. Seats 6 around town and sleeps 2 in single berths or a king sized double bed.
Make yourself at home… when your day’s touring is over and its time to make camp; the Jabiru’s interior will make you feel right at home. Gas 3 burner stove, oven and grill, large 12 volt compressor fridge/freezer, microwave oven, ensuite with hot water on tap and a luxurious lounge room.

The ergonomic design and interior comfort of the Sprinter now rivals passenger car levels and excellent all-round vision is available thanks to the large sweeping windscreen and side windows.
Easy to Drive… the Mercedes based Jabiru has set new standards for Motorhomes whilst achieving new levels of customer satisfaction and safety… the Jabiru can be driven with a normal passenger car license.
Full height walk-through from the driving compartment makes access from the front cabin into the living area extremely easy.
More power, higher performance and lower fuel consumption… the new diesel turbocharged engine develops 95kW and a massive 300Nm of torque. Available in 5-speed manual or 6-speed Sprintshift automatic transmission.
Four-wheel disc brakes to optimise braking and 45,000 km major service intervals to ensure low running costs.
3 Year/100,000 km warranty and 24-hour roadside assist service.
The general price range is $105,000 - $120,000 including GST depending on configuration and the accessories fitted.

Jabiru is designed and manufactured by TRAKKA, an Australian company, established in 1973, specialising in designing, engineering and building Recreation and Special Purpose Vehicles.

Mercedes-Benz Sandpiper Specifications

Mercedes-Benz Sandpiper - April 2006

Engine

Type Diesel with turbocharger and intercooler
Injection Common Rail Direct Injection (CDI)
Displacement 2685cc
Cylinders 5
Maximum power 115kW @ 3800rpm
Maximum torque 330Nm @ 1400-2400rpm
Transmission

Manual 5-speed
Auto 5-speed Auto
Drive Rear Wheel
Suspension & Steering

Steering Power assisted rack-and-pinion
Front Independent with damper strut, transverse semi-elliptic leaf spring and stabiliser bar
Rear Live axle with telescopic gas-filled shock absorbers, longitudinal semi-elliptic leaf spring and stabiliser bar
Wheels & Tyres

Wheels
5.5J x 15 steel
Tyres 195 / 70R 15 (Dual rear wheels)
Brakes

Front / Rear Disc brakes front and rear
External Dimmensions (metres)
Length
7.1
Width 2.45
Height 3
Wheelbase 4.025
Turning circle 14.3
Ground clearance 189mm
Internal Dimmensions (mm)

Width 2300
Height 1975
Bed 2050 x 1350
Cap bed 2250 x 1150
Capacities (Fridge & Tanks in Litres)

Seating 4
Sleeping Births 4
Fridge / Freezer 130/65
Fresh water tank 125
Hot water tank 20
Grey water tank 100
Toilet waste tank 17
Fuel tank 75
Battery Charger 30Amp
Auxiliary battery 2 x 200Ah (Total 400Ah)
Vehicle Battery 88Ah
Alternator 90Amp
Weights (kgs)

Tare (10% Fuel, Full Water and Gas) 3692 (excl. accessories)
GVM 4490
Max payload (excl. accessories) 798
Max towable 1500
